Linux制作之进门级进修:Linux进修偏向和办法浅谈仓酷云
但不会命令而成为高手也是不可能的.这就好比学英语,什么语法都不懂,只捧着单词手册背单词是学不会英语的,但是没有单词词汇量英语水平也提不高的。因为自己是做Linux培训的,以是关于初学Linux体系的伴侣打仗的对照多,关于初学Linux时碰到的成绩懂得的也够深入,以下行动有不周密的中央看伴侣们指出:
起首申明但愿学Linux的伴侣可以健忘Windows2000,最最少健忘Windows下的盘符、使用程序等基本的工具,其主要深入分明Linux和Windows是2个分歧的体系平台,能够往对照着进修,但不要间接拿Windows那套工具间接套用到Linux进修中。
进修偏向:
1、桌面体系
就是体系安装好后的视窗体系,在Windows下叫Windows,在Linux下叫XWindows,实在只是名字纷歧样罢了(看看红旗做的桌面,真是跟Windows要做象有多象,真晕,如许固然有助于Linux桌面的利用,但关于Linux体系的推行真是没甚么优点)
良多初学Linux人的安装好Linux后,进进其XWindows桌面,镇静不已,觉得半途而废,Linux本人会了,这类设法是很可骇的;假如我告知你Linux的XWindows情况不是Linux体系,它只是在Linux上面运转的使用程序(相似于在Windows下运转office2000),你是怎样想的?
Windows下的使用程序几近是不克不及间接在Linux体系下安装和利用,学编程的应当分明,以是不要往找Windows工具盘安装你的RAR,QQ,realone等经常使用工具,你是装不上的。
你能够实验往安装你硬件的最新驱动程序,安装Linux下的经常使用工具,做一些Linux复杂的汉化,你就会了解常常在论坛里问这方面成绩的伴侣的坚苦了。
总之,学桌面,不是学Linux体系。
2、内核源代码进修
跟unix操纵体系一样都是用C言语编写。
往买正版的Linux体系(不是很贵),会附带一张大概2张Linux源代码盘,Linux程序员从这里入手下手,是出发点也是尽头。
3、体系办理
也就是办理Linux体系情况:SHELL、图形、体系服务、硬件驱动等等。
体系办理Linux跟UNIX相似(是看了些Unix体系办理才如许说的),基础上都是经由过程命令----->设置文件----->剧本文件。
初学这倡议从这里入手下手,不要一味往安装XWindows,这个XWindows情况只需你只管坚持常常利用,信任学会是天然而然的事变.(感到那实在没甚么勤学的,只需盘算机使用在1年以上的伴侣,应当都能鄙人面操纵吧)
4、使用开辟
在Linux使用上,Linux的确跟它的合作敌手Windows比拟另有必定的差异。不外在高真个使用上,Linux的市场是愈来愈年夜,如:
Linux内核开辟:
----PDA团体掌上电脑;
----公用的收集设备;防火墙设备,VPN设备等是用Linux编写的,国产的,如今发卖的非常不错;
----硬件驱动程序
Linux收集编程:
----php编程,创建静态站点;
----jsp编程,
----perl,cgi编程;
Linux体系下数据库的开辟:
----mysql中小型数据库体系;
----oracle数据库
----DB2数据库,IBM数据库体系
5、服务器范畴
一说Linux,良多天然就想到了做服务器,但如今收集服务器方面,Linux的市场占据率的确是第一的;
Linux服务器范畴:
----代办署理服务器,利用的是Linux的iptables功效;
----影戏服务器,利用的是Linux的samba服务的功效,文件和打印共享服务器
----游戏服务器,cs服务器,在Linux体系下利用cs的Linux版本创建的服务器
----客户存档服务器,接纳的Linux的ftp服务器,经常使用的有:wu-ftp,pro-ftp软件创建的
----www服务器,利用的是Linux下的apache服务器软件
----ftp服务器,下载服务器,利用的是Linux下的wu-ftp,pro-ftp,vs-ftp软件
----mail服务器,接纳的是Linux下的sendmail,qmail软件
----dns服务器,利用的是Linux下的bind软件
----数据库服务器,利用的是mysql大概oracle软件
----防火墙,软件防火墙服务器,利用的是Linux的iptables功效创建的
----路由器,软路由器,利用的是Linux下的routed软件创建的
----拨号服务器,vpn服务器等等
6、体系集成
局限太广,内容太多。信任IBM等创建的Linux研发中央次要就是做这个的。
给你装的系统里为ubuntu12.04,它已经封装的很臃肿了,但是考虑到你没有很多时间投入其中,所以给你装了它,但是怎么用它提高开发效率,需要你在学习的过程中不断总结; 其次,Linux简单易学,因为我们初学者只是学的基础部分,Linux的结构体系非常清晰,再加上老师循序渐进的教学以及耐心的讲解,使我们理解起来很快,短期内就基本掌握了操作和运行模式。 选择交流平台,如QQ群,网站论坛等。 上课传授的不仅仅是知识,更重要的是一些道理,包括一些做人的道理,讲课时也抓住重点,循序渐进,让同学理解很快;更可贵的是不以你过去的成绩看问题. 随着实验课程的结束,理论课也该结束了,说实话教OS的这两位老师是我们遇到过的不错的老师(这话放这可能不太恰当). 尽我能力帮助他人,在帮助他人的同时你会深刻巩固知识。 我感觉linux的学习,学习编程~!~!就去学习C语言编程!! linux鸟哥的私房菜,第三版,基础篇,网上有pdf下的,看它的目录和每章的介绍就行了,这个绝对原创! 安装一个新的软件时先看README,再看INSTALL然后看FAQ,最后才动手安装,这样遇到问题就知道为什么。如果Linux说明文档不看,结果出了问题再去论坛来找答案反而浪费时间。 Linux只是个内核!这点很重要,你必须理解这一点。只有一个内核是不能构成一个操作系统的。 用户下达的命令解释给系统去执行,并将系统传回的信息再次解释给用户,估shell也称为命令解释器,有关命令的学习可参考论坛相关文章,精通英文也是学习Linux的关键。 学习Linux,应该怎样学,主要学些什么,一位Linux热心学习者,一段学习Linux的风云经验,历时十二个小时的思考总结,近十位网络Linux学习者权威肯定,为您学习Linux指明方向。 得到到草率的回答或者根本得不到任何Linux答案。越表现出在寻求帮助前为解决问题付出的努力,你越能得到实质性的帮助。 一定要学好命令,shell是命令语言,命令解释程序及程序设计语言的统称,shell也负责用户和操作系统之间的沟通。 Linux的成功就在于用最少的资源最短的时间实现了所有功能,这也是符合人类进化的,相信以后节能问题会日益突出。 我们自学,就这个循环的过程中,我们学习了基本操作,用vi,shell,模拟内存的分配过程等一些OS管理。 再次,Linux是用C语言编写的,我们有学习C语言的基础,读程序和编写代码方面存在的困难小一点,也是我们能较快掌握的原因之一。? 选择交流平台,如QQ群,网站论坛等。 请问谁有Linux的学习心得的吗?简单的说说? 对Linux命令熟悉后,你可以开始搭建一个小的Linux网络,这是最好的实践方法。Linux是网络的代名词,Linux网络服务功能非常强大,不论是邮件服务器、Web服务器、DNS服务器等都非常完善。
页:
[1]